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82424636432 606112 02960 39314 7709060892
74856 603936 7738
74856 603936 7738
107338301 975 9689952
All about undefined
Interested in learning more?
74856 603936 7738
107338301 975 9689952
See more
29802239 9364
464902180 758 0953967558
See more
11420 221
93837 86 3726 35264 81228279339
See more